研究了一种新型模拟双折射结构DWDM滤波器的中心频率和带宽的可调谐特性.研究表明:当给定满足一定平坦化要求的光谱透射率所需的各模拟波片中偏振旋转器的旋转角时,通过模拟波片中楔形介质对的相对位移来调节光在各模拟波片中的光程差,同时保持光程差仍满足特定的比例关系,可实现中心频率及带宽的调谐.当光在各模拟波片中的光程差变化较小时,可实现中心频率的调谐,此时带宽的改变很小,可忽略不计;随着光程差变化的不断增大,带宽的改变则不能忽略. 相似文献

Detrended fluctuation analysis (DFA) is a scaling method commonly used for detecting long-range correlations in non-stationary time series. The DFA method uses a trend based on polynomial fitting to extract and quantify fluctuations at different time scales. Basically, such procedure acts as a (non-dynamical) high-pass filter that removes time series components below a given time scale. As an alternative to the polynomial fitting approach, this paper proposes a DFA method based on well-known high-pass filters (e.g., Butterworth, elliptic, etc.). Numerical results show that the proposed DFA approach yields results similar to traditional DFA method. Maybe, the main advantage of the proposed DFA method is that efficient implementations of high-pass filters are available commercially. 相似文献

Electrospinning is a versatile process for drawing fibers of diverse materials including polymers, ceramics, and composites. We demonstrate here its application in the synthesis of complex ceramic oxide materials. The phase formation and morphology of BaTiO3 nanofibers synthesized via electrospinning is investigated as a function of heat treatment conditions. Fully crystallized BaTiO3 nanofibers with the perovskite structure are obtained after annealing at 750 °C and show an average grain size of about 30 nm. Tetragonal crystal structure of the fibers is indicated by XRD peak splitting (calculated c/a ratio=1.007), and confirmed by Raman spectroscopy. Furthermore, the advancement in heat treatment of the electrospun fibers yields single crystalline BaTiO3 nanofibers with 50 nm in diameter and lengths up to 1 μm. 相似文献

Background
The malignant cells of cutaneous T cell lymphoma (CTCL) display immunogenic peptides derived from the clonal T cell receptor (TCR) providing an attractive model for refinement of anti-tumor immunization methodology. To produce a clinically meaningful anti-tumor response, induction of cytotoxic anti-CTCL cells must be maximized while suppressive T regulatory cells (Treg) should be minimized. We have demonstrated that engulfment of apoptotic CTCL cells by dendritic cells (DC) can lead to either CD8 anti-CTCL responses or immunosuppressive Treg induction. Treg generation is favored when the number of apoptotic cells available for ingestion is high. 相似文献946.

A family of monodisperse YF3, YF3:Ce3+ and YF3:Ce3+/Ln3+ (Ln=Tb, Eu) mesocrystals with a morphology of a hollow spindle can be synthesized by a solvothermal process using yttrium nitrate and NH4F as precursors. The effects of reaction time, fluorine source, solvents, and reaction temperature on the synthesis of these mesocrystals have been studied in detail. The results demonstrate that the formation of a hollow spindle‐like YF3 can be ascribed to a nonclassical crystallization process by means of a particle‐based reaction route in ethanol. It has been shown that the fluorine sources selected have a remarkable effect on the morphologies and crystalline phases of the final products. Moreover, the luminescent properties of Ln3+‐doped and Ce3+/Ln3+‐co‐doped spindle‐like YF3 mesocrystals were also investigated. It turns out that Ce3+ is an efficient sensitizer for Ln3+ in the spindle‐like YF3 mesocrystals. Remarkable fluorescence enhancement was observed in Ce3+/Ln3+‐co‐doped YF3 mesocrystals. The mechanism of the energy transfer and electronic transition between Ce3+ and Ln3+ in the host material of YF3 mesocrystals was also explored. The cytotoxicity study revealed that these YF3‐based nanocrystals are biocompatible for applications, such as cellular imaging. 相似文献

In this paper, we put our focus on a variable-coe~cient fifth-order Korteweg-de Vries (fKdV) equation, which possesses a great number of excellent properties and is of current importance in physical and engineering fields. Certain constraints are worked out, which make sure the integrability of such an equation. Under those constraints, some integrable properties are derived, such as the Lax pair and Darboux transformation. Via the Darboux transformation, which is an exercisable way to generate solutions in a recursive manner, the one- and two-solitonic solutions are presented and the relevant physical applications of these solitonic structures in some fields are also pointed out. 相似文献

We show that the large-N limits of certainconformal field theories in various dimensions includein their Hilbert space a sector describing supergravityon the product of anti-de Sitter spacetimes, spheres, and other compact manifolds. This is shown bytaking some branes in the full M/string theory and thentaking a low-energy limit where the field theory on thebrane decouples from the bulk. We observe that, in this limit, we can still trust thenear-horizon geometry for large N. The enhancedsupersymmetries of the near-horizon geometry correspondto the extra supersymmetry generators present in thesuperconformal group (as opposed to just the super-Poincaregroup). The 't Hooft limit of 3 + 1 N = 4 super-Yang–Mills at the conformal pointis shown to contain strings: they are IIB strings. Weconjecture that compactifications of M/string theory on various anti-de Sitterspacetimes is dual to various conformal field theories.This leads to a new proposal for a definition ofM-theory which could be extended to include fivenoncompact dimensions. 相似文献
